✅ 100% Free - No Credit Card Required

Free Sitemap XML Generator

Generate XML sitemap to help search engines discover all your website pages. Improve SEO and ensure complete indexing.

Last Updated: 15 Jan 2026

sitemap.xml

0 URLs
<?xml version="1.0" encoding="UTF-8"?>
<urlset xmlns="http://www.sitemaps.org/schemas/sitemap/0.9">
</urlset>

What is an XML Sitemap?

An XML sitemap is a file that lists all pages on your website in a structured format that search engines can easily read and understand. It acts as a roadmap for search engine crawlers, helping them discover, index, and understand all the content on your site, even pages that might not be easily found through internal linking.

XML sitemaps are crucial for SEO because they ensure search engines can find and index all your pages efficiently. They're especially important for large websites, new sites with few external links, sites with rich media content, or sites with complex navigation structures. A well-structured sitemap improves your site's visibility in search results.

Why Use Our Free Sitemap XML Generator?

SEO Optimization

Help search engines discover and index all your pages efficiently. Improve your site's visibility and ensure no content is missed by crawlers.

Standard Compliant

Generate XML sitemaps that follow Google's sitemap protocol standards. Compatible with all major search engines including Google, Bing, and Yahoo.

Instant Generation

Create XML sitemaps instantly by entering your URLs. No complex coding required. Generate sitemaps ready to submit to Google Search Console.

Common Use Cases for XML Sitemaps

Website Indexing

  • New Website Launch

    Help search engines discover and index all pages on a new website quickly. Ensure your content is found even without external links.

  • Large Websites

    For sites with hundreds or thousands of pages, sitemaps ensure all content is discovered. Break large sitemaps into multiple files if needed.

  • Deep Content

    Pages buried deep in your site structure may not be easily found through internal linking. Sitemaps ensure they're indexed.

SEO Management

  • Google Search Console

    Submit sitemaps to Google Search Console to help Google understand your site structure and prioritize crawling important pages.

  • Content Updates

    When you add new pages or update content, update your sitemap to notify search engines of changes and ensure fresh content is indexed quickly.

  • Rich Media Content

    Sitemaps help search engines discover images, videos, and other media content that might not be easily found through standard crawling.

How XML Sitemaps Work

1

Create Your Sitemap

List all your website URLs in XML format. Include important metadata like last modification date, change frequency, and priority for each page.

2

Upload to Your Server

Place your sitemap.xml file in your website's root directory (e.g., yoursite.com/sitemap.xml) so search engines can access it.

3

Submit to Search Engines

Submit your sitemap to Google Search Console and Bing Webmaster Tools. You can also reference it in your robots.txt file for automatic discovery.

4

Monitor & Update

Regularly update your sitemap when you add new pages or change content. Search engines will re-crawl your sitemap periodically to discover updates.

XML Sitemap Best Practices

Keep Under 50,000 URLs

Google recommends sitemaps with no more than 50,000 URLs. For larger sites, create multiple sitemaps and use a sitemap index file.

Tip: Use sitemap index files to organize multiple sitemaps for better management.

File Size Limit

Keep individual sitemap files under 50MB uncompressed. Use gzip compression to reduce file size if needed.

Tip: Compressed sitemaps (.xml.gz) are supported and reduce bandwidth usage.

Include Only Indexable Pages

Only include pages you want search engines to index. Exclude duplicate content, private pages, or pages blocked by robots.txt.

Tip: Include canonical URLs only to avoid duplicate content issues.

Update Regularly

Keep your sitemap current. Update it when you add new pages, remove old ones, or make significant content changes.

Tip: Set up automatic sitemap generation if your CMS supports it.

Frequently Asked Questions

Do I need a sitemap for SEO?

While not required, sitemaps are highly recommended, especially for large sites, new sites, or sites with complex structures. They help ensure all your pages are discovered and indexed by search engines.

Where should I place my sitemap?

Place your sitemap.xml file in your website's root directory (e.g., yoursite.com/sitemap.xml). You can also reference it in robots.txt and submit it directly to Google Search Console.

How often should I update my sitemap?

Update your sitemap whenever you add new pages, remove pages, or make significant content changes. For active sites, update weekly or monthly. For static sites, update as needed.

Can I have multiple sitemaps?

Yes! For large sites, create multiple sitemaps (e.g., one per section) and use a sitemap index file to list them all. This makes management easier and keeps files under size limits.

Related Tools

Explore more tools in this category

Popular Tools

Most used tools across all categories

Need More SEO & Marketing Tools?

Explore our complete collection of free seo & marketing tools. All tools are 100% free, require no sign-up, and work instantly in your browser.